The suspended solids Analyzer is a sophisticated sensor that uses a built-in LED light source to emit a beam of 880nm. After the beam is scattered by suspended solids in the sample, the signal intensity is measured by the detector to measure the suspended solids concentration of the sample. Since the LED emits 880nm near-infrared, it will not be affected by the color of the water sample. It is unique in that it can measure low to high concentrations of suspended solids. Ideal for wastewater, drinking water monitoring, mixed liquor suspended solids monitoring, and many more applications that require the use of traditional turbidimeters or suspended solids analyzers. Suspended solids sensors can be equipped with a self-cleaning feature that sprays water or air onto the optical windows to keep them clean and extend sensor maintenance intervals.

Oil in Water Analyzer

Oil in water analyzer is based on the principle of fluorescence method to excite the target substance in water with a beam of predetermined wavelength, and then make the target substance produce fluorescence. Compared with the traditional absorbance method, the fluorescence method has better sample selectivity, creating a model that can continuously and accurately measure the oil in water.
